MY BOOK MIRROR EDITION USER MANUAL 9 Replacing a Drive My Book Mirror Edition is a limited user-serviceable product which allows for servicing of one or both internal hard drives in the enclosure. Important: Only WD Caviar® GP hard drive assemblies can be inserted into the My Book Mirror Edition enclosure. In the event a fault occurs and you would like to service the device yourself, visit WD Technical Support at support.wdc.com and search the knowledge base article 1709 for detailed instructions on obtaining a replacement drive. When contacting Technical Support, have the following items ready: My Book serial number, date of purchase, and the serial number of the internal hard drive(s) which require replacement. Once you have received the replacement drive(s), follow the steps below to service the dual-drive storage system. Important: To avoid electrostatic discharge (ESD) problems, ground yourself by touching the metal chassis of the computer before handling the device. Before getting started, power off the unit and disconnect all of its cables. 1. Place the unit on a clean and stable surface. 2. Using your thumb, firmly push down on the top front panel of the unit to release the latch and open the cover. REPLACING A DRIVE - 22
